What affects the price

Remodeling costs vary based on your specific goals. Choosing high-end materials like natural stone or premium fixtures will shift your budget higher, while selecting standard options helps keep things affordable. The biggest price factor is the scope of work; a simple tub-to-shower conversion costs significantly less than a total gut renovation that moves plumbing lines or electrical outlets. Structural repairs found behind old walls can also influence the bottom line.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What kind of wood bathroom vanity is best for Wichita homes?

For Wichita homes, wood bathroom vanities made from solid hardwood like oak or maple, sealed with a moisture-resistant finish, are recommended to withstand our climate's humidity fluctuations. Engineered wood options with a robust laminate or veneer are also durable. The pros can guide you on materials that offer both style and longevity.

What bathroom wall panels are recommended for Wichita bathrooms?

In Wichita bathrooms, moisture-resistant wall panels made from materials like PVC or composite are a good choice, especially in shower areas, for their durability and ease of cleaning. These offer a modern look and are simpler to maintain than traditional tile and grout. The pros can discuss installation and aesthetic options.
